What Our Bathroom Renovation Service Covers
Not every bathroom needs stripping back to the slab. We quote five distinct scopes, and the site survey decides which one your bathroom actually needs. If the existing waterproofing is sound and you are only changing the look, we will tell you so rather than sell you a gut.
Full Gut Renovation
Everything out, back to the structural slab. New waterproofing, new screed and falls, new plumbing rough-in, new electrical, new tiling, new sanitaryware and joinery. The right call when the bathroom is over ten years old, when there is any sign of damp in the unit below, or when you are moving fixture positions.
Partial Refresh
Fixtures, vanity, mixers, shower glass, mirror, lighting, and re-grouting, with the existing tiles and membrane left in place. Fastest and cheapest route, suitable for rental turnarounds and for bathrooms where the waterproofing checks out. We inspect before recommending it.
Wet-Room Conversion
Removing the bath or the shower tray and forming a level-access wet room with a linear channel drain or a tiled gradient to a point drain. This is the scope where getting the falls and the tanking right matters most, since there is no tray edge holding water back.
Guest WC & Powder Room
Small no-shower spaces where the finish carries the whole room. Feature wall tiling or stone, wall-hung WC with concealed cistern, counter-top basin, and lighting. Low wet-works risk, so the budget goes into materials rather than membranes.
Master En-Suite
Larger layouts with a separate shower and bath, double vanity, bespoke joinery, and often a freestanding tub or steam enclosure. Longer programme because of joinery and stone lead times, and usually the scope that needs the most coordination with the building.
Multi-Bathroom & Villa Packages
Two to six bathrooms renovated in one programme across a villa or a portfolio unit. We phase them so the property keeps at least one working bathroom throughout, and the shared mobilisation, NOC, and skip costs are spread across the whole package.

Our Bathroom Renovation Process, Step by Step
Bathrooms are the tightest sequencing job in any property. Every trade waits on the one before it to cure or clear out, so the order below is fixed and the durations are real. This is the programme we work to on a standard Dubai apartment bathroom.
Site Survey & Quote
We measure the room, check the existing membrane and screed condition, trace the drainage and the chilled-water fan coil in the ceiling void, and confirm what your building will and will not allow. You get an itemised fixed-price quote, not a lump sum.
Design & Material Selection
Layout drawings, a tile and sanitaryware selection session, and a written specification. We confirm stock and lead times before you sign, because imported stone and specified sanitaryware are the usual cause of a slipped finish date.
NOC & Approvals
We assemble and submit the building management NOC and, where the scope moves plumbing, the Dubai Municipality or Trakhees permit. Drawings, method statement, trade licence, and insurance all come from us.
Protection & Demolition
Corridor, lift lobby, and door protection go in first to satisfy the building deposit conditions. Then strip-out back to slab, with waste removed to a licensed tip and the skip booked through the building.
Waterproofing & Tanking
Substrate prep, primer, reinforcement tape at every junction, then a minimum two-coat membrane across the floor and up the shower walls to at least 1.8 m. Full cure between coats, no exceptions.
Flood Test & Sign-Off
The drain is plugged and the floor is ponded for 24 to 48 hours. We photograph the water level at the start and the end and check the ceiling of the unit below. Only a passed test releases the tiling stage.
Screed, Falls & Tiling
Screed laid to a positive fall towards the drain, then floor and wall tiling over the membrane using the correct adhesive, slip-rated floor tiles, edge trims, and sealed or epoxy grout in the wet zone.
MEP First & Second Fix
Plumbing connections, thermostatic mixers, concealed cisterns, wet-zone rated outlets and lighting circuits, exhaust fan, and heated towel rail wiring, all tested and certified.
Fit-Off, Snagging & Handover
Vanity, sanitaryware, shower glass, mirror, and accessories installed, silicone applied, then a joint snag walk with you. We close every item before handover and issue your warranty and flood test documentation.
Realistic Timeline: What to Expect
A standard 4 to 7 m² Dubai apartment bathroom takes 9 to 17 working days on site, or roughly 3 to 5 weeks from signature to handover once approvals and deliveries are counted. Waterproofing and its flood test take 5 to 7 working days of that and cannot be compressed. A master en-suite with bespoke joinery runs 4 to 6 weeks, and custom-cut marble or imported sanitaryware can add 2 weeks of lead time. NOC turnaround is the most common reason a start date moves, so we build a buffer into the programme rather than promising a date we cannot hold.
Waterproofing and Tanking to Dubai Municipality Standard
This is the part of a Dubai bathroom that separates a good contractor from a cheap one, and it is the part you cannot inspect once the tiles are on. Water that gets past a failed membrane does not stay in your bathroom. It travels through the screed and shows up as a stain on the ceiling of the apartment below, which turns a private renovation into a building management dispute and an insurance claim.
Dubai Municipality building code requires waterproofing across the full wet area, with shower walls tanked to a minimum height of 1.8 m, reinforcement at all corners and joints, and integration with the floor drain. We apply a minimum two-coat liquid membrane system to a combined dry film thickness of at least 1 mm, with tanking tape bedded into every internal corner, floor to wall junction, pipe penetration, and drain surround before the membrane goes on.
Then we test it. The drain is plugged, the floor is ponded, and the water sits for 24 to 48 hours. We record the start level, the end level, and the condition of the ceiling below, with timestamped photographs. If the level drops or a damp patch appears, the membrane gets rectified and retested before anyone opens a box of tiles. Most Dubai facilities management companies now ask for that test record before they release the fit-out deposit, and we hand it over as part of the closeout pack.
Our Waterproofing Specification
- ✓Substrate cleaned, repaired, and primed back to sound screed or slab
- ✓Reinforcement tape at every corner, junction, pipe penetration, and drain
- ✓Minimum two-coat liquid membrane, at least 1 mm combined dry film thickness
- ✓Shower walls tanked to 1.8 m minimum, full floor coverage as standard
- ✓Full cure time between coats, never over-coated wet to hit a deadline
- ✓24 to 48 hour flood test with timestamped photo record before tiling
- ✓Screed laid to a positive fall so water reaches the drain, not the corners
- ✓Written workmanship warranty on the waterproofing system
Building NOC and Approvals for Wet Works
Wet works in a Dubai apartment attract more scrutiny than any other renovation, for the obvious reason that a leak affects neighbours. Renovel handles the paperwork end to end. You are not chasing your building manager, and you are not the one explaining a method statement.
Building / FM NOC
Required by almost every Dubai building before mobilisation, even for cosmetic work. Fees commonly run AED 200–1,500, plus a refundable security deposit of AED 2,000–10,000 held against damage to lifts and common areas.
Municipality Permit
Needed once you move a drain, soil point, wet wall, or MEP service. Dubai Municipality approval typically takes 5 to 10 working days with correct drawings. Buildings inside Trakhees zones such as parts of Palm Jumeirah or Dubai Healthcare City go through Trakhees instead, at 7 to 14 days.
Documents We Prepare
As-built and proposed drawings, contractor DED trade licence, method statement, insurance certificates, work programme and site timings, plus the building NOC application form. You supply the title deed or tenancy contract.
Working Hours & Rules
Residential noise hours are generally 07:00 to 20:00 on weekdays and 09:00 to 20:00 on Saturdays, with no noisy work on Fridays and public holidays. Several communities enforce tighter windows, and we programme around whichever applies to your building.
Starting permit-triggering work without approval is an expensive mistake in Dubai: fines start around AED 5,000, a stop-work order lands the same day, and unauthorised work can be ordered out again. It is also the fastest way to lose your security deposit. Materials and Finishes Chosen for UAE Humidity
Dubai summers push indoor humidity high and bathroom extract runs hard for months at a time. Materials that behave perfectly in a European bathroom swell, corrode, or grow mould here. Our default specification is chosen for that, and we will talk you out of finishes that will not last.
Large-Format Porcelain
Our standard recommendation. Near zero water absorption, no sealing needed, and fewer grout lines to discolour. Marble-effect porcelain gives the look of stone for far less, with none of the maintenance.
Natural Marble, Specified Carefully
Beautiful and popular for feature walls and vanity tops. It needs annual resealing in a wet area and a suitable slip rating on floors. We supply and install it ourselves when the look justifies the upkeep.
Epoxy or Sealed Grout
Standard cement grout stains and harbours mould in a high-humidity shower. Epoxy grout in the wet zone costs a little more to lay and stays clean for years longer.
Moisture-Resistant Board & Paint
Above the tile line we use bathroom-grade moisture-resistant paint and, where a ceiling is boarded, water-resistant gypsum with an access hatch to the chilled-water fan coil unit.
Marine-Grade Vanity Carcasses
Standard MDF swells within a couple of Dubai summers. We build vanities in moisture-resistant board or plywood with sealed edges and soft-close hardware rated for humid conditions.
Correctly Sized Extraction
The cheapest defence against mould is air movement. We size the exhaust fan to the room volume, duct it properly rather than into the ceiling void, and add a run-on timer or humidity sensor.

How long does a bathroom renovation take in Dubai?
▾
A standard 4 to 7 m² apartment bathroom takes 9 to 17 working days of site time, or 3 to 5 weeks from signature to handover once NOC approval and material delivery are included. A master en-suite with bespoke joinery runs 4 to 6 weeks. Waterproofing alone accounts for 5 to 7 working days because the membrane has to cure and the flood test cannot be shortened. We give you a dated programme before mobilising and update it weekly.

Can you renovate a bathroom while we are still living in the apartment?
▾
Yes, and most of our apartment jobs are occupied properties. We seal the bathroom doorway with a dust barrier, protect the corridor and lift lobby to satisfy the building deposit conditions, run a dedicated waste route, and work only inside permitted hours, usually 07:00 to 20:00 on weekdays and 09:00 to 20:00 on Saturdays, with no noisy work on Fridays or public holidays. In a single-bathroom home we sequence the strip-out and fit-off to keep the downtime to the shortest possible window and agree it with you in advance.
